Step‑by‑Step Guide to Building Your Big Plan
-
Define Your Vision
- Write a clear, inspiring statement of what you want to achieve.
- Ask: What would my ideal life look like in 5, 10, or 20 years?
-
Set Specific Goals
- Break the vision into measurable goals (e.g., career, health, relationships).
- Use the SMART framework: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time‑bound.
-
Identify Resources
- List skills, finances, mentors, and tools you already have.
- Pinpoint gaps that need to be filled.
-
Create an Action Plan
- Draft a timeline with milestones and deadlines.
- Assign responsibilities and track progress.
-
Review & Adjust
- Schedule monthly check‑ins to assess progress.
- Be flexible: adjust goals when circumstances change.
Tools & Resources
| Tool | Purpose | Why It Helps |
|---|---|---|
| Trello | Visual task board | Keeps tasks organized and visible |
| Evernote | Note‑taking app | Centralizes ideas and research |
| Google Calendar | Scheduling | Reminds you of deadlines |
| MindMeister | Brainstorming | Clarifies complex ideas |
